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: - Capacity to consent - Internet access (tablet or smartphone) - Sufficient knowledge of German - Confirmed pregnancy between the 12th and 35th week of pregnancy at the time of study inclusion - Planned delivery at one of the study centers
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: - Patients who are unable to provide informed consent and cooperation due to mental or cognitive impairments. - Patients who have not provided informed consent or who do not agree to the data protection regulations or who withdraw their consent. - Patients without internet access - Insufficient German language skills - Patients who are not giving birth at one of the participating centers.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Correlation between duration of use (high user/low user) of the study application and differences in self-assessment of knowledge and utilization of support services in the areas of: a) psychosocial, b) family/partnership, c) exercise/nutrition, measured using a 5-point Likert scale at the start of app use, at 36+0 weeks of gestation, and 3 months postpartum.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| - Improvement in health-related parameters over the course of the study (T1-T5) and group comparison depending on duration of use (high user/low user) - Prediction of premature birth (<37+0 weeks of gestation), early premature rupture of membranes (<37+0 weeks of gestation), preeclampsia. The test quality criteria are calculated. - Traceability of the AI-generated information regarding the indication for the "Early Help" support service after delivery, as well as regarding recommendations for or against VBAC (vaginal birth after cesarean) – there are no defined outcome measures for this question. | — |
